What is an EICR report?

An electrical installation certificate report is required because all electrical installations deteriorate over time. It is recommended that they be inspected and tested every 3 to 5 years. Such electrical safety checks are commonly referred to as “periodic inspections” or “reports about the electrical installation”. On your EICR Report London …

Electric inspection process

Any errors in the installation are detected during the inspection. As well as damaged accessories. This is achieved through visual inspections of accessible wiring and accessories and a series of electrical tests on each individual circuit to identify any wiring defects that are not visible during the visual inspection.
